It is important to follow your doctors instructions regarding the dosage and duration of using Maligon Syrup Taking it with food can help reduce the risk of stomach upset Make sure you do not skip any doses and complete the full course of treatment even if you start feeling better Stopping the medication prematurely can lead to treatment failure and increased side effects If you miss a dose do not take a double dose to make up for it Simply take the next scheduled dose To minimize the risk of mosquito bites use insect repellent creams on exposed areas of your body especially if you are outdoors after sunset Additionally spray mosquito repellent in rooms even if they have screening Wearing lightcolored and covered clothing can also help protect against mosquito bites Some common side effects of this medication include rash headache dizziness and vomiting It may also cause stomach pain diarrhea loss of appetite and nausea If these side effects persist for a prolonged period it is advisable to consult your doctor Inform your doctor if you have diabetes because Maligon Syrup can lower blood sugar levels Diabetic patients should regularly monitor their blood sugar levels This medication may also cause blurred vision so regular eye examinations are recommended If you experience unexplained bruising or bleeding sore throat fever or persistent fatigue inform your doctor promptly Please note that the context of the content has not been changed

Is Maligon safe in G6PD deficiency?

No, as there may be a risk of hemolysis in patients with G6PD deficiency. Always consult your doctor regarding its use

Is Coec safe in G6PD deficiency?

It is not recommended to use this medication in patients with G6PD deficiency due to the potential risk of hemolysis It is crucial to consult with your doctor before considering its use in such cases G6PD deficiency is an inherited disorder that affects the red blood cells leading to their destruction under certain conditions Certain medications including this one can trigger a hemolytic episode in individuals with G6PD deficiency causing a rapid breakdown of red blood cells and potentially leading to serious complications Therefore it is essential to confirm with your healthcare provider if this medication is safe for you to use considering your medical history and any underlying conditions you may have Your doctor will be able to determine the most suitable treatment options for you considering both the benefits and potential risks associated with the medication Always prioritize your health and follow professional medical advice to ensure the best possible outcomes
